Jennifer made a baby blanket that is 2 feet by 3 feet. She has a queen size blanket that is 6 feet by 9 feet. How does the area of the baby's blank t compare to the size of the queen sized blanket?
The area of the queen sized blanket is 9 times bigger than the area baby blanket.
What is the area of a rectangle?
The area of a rectangle is the multiplication of it's length and breadth.
Here, the area of the baby blanket = 2 × 3 square feet = 6 square feet.
The area of the queen sized blanket = 6 × 9 square feet = 54 square feet.
Therefore, the ratio of the baby blanket : queen sized blanket
= 6 : 54
= 1 : 9
Hence, area of the queen sized blanket is 9 times bigger than the area baby blanket.

A home business has an average income of $900.00 per month with a standard deviation of $15.00 if the income given month is $930.00 what z-score corresponds to this value
Answer:
Z score is a statistical that corresponds to the standarization of the regular score to a normal dsitribution
The formula for Z score is Z = [X - mean ]./ (standar deviation)
Here X = 930.00; mean = 900.00; and standard deviation = 15.00
Then, Z = [930.00 - 900.00] / 15.00 = 30.00 / 15.00 = 2.00
Answer: 2.00

the average of three numbers is 1/5. Two of the numbers are 1/4 and 1/3. what is the third number?
Answer:
The third number is 1/60
Step-by-step explanation:
Let the denominator of the number = x
1/4 + 1/3 + 1/x = 1/5
1/4 + 1/3 = 3/12 + 4/12 = 7/12
The lowest common denominator is 60x.
(7/12 + 1/x)/3 = 1/5 Remember that this is the average of 3 numbers. That's what the 3 is doing on the left. Multiply both sides by 3
7/12 + 1/x = 3/5 Multiply through by 60x
35x + 60 = 36x
x = 60

The Smithtown water company uses warm water meters that measure water usage in gallons. They charge $.12 per gallon of water. If Jack's previous meter reading was 45,621 gallons and his present water reading is 48,555 gallons what is the amount of his water bill?
Subtract to find the number of gallons used:
48,555 - 45621 = 2,934 gallons.
Multiply gallons used by price per gallon:
2,934 x 0.12 = $352.08
-2x-3y=-7
y+1=x
solve for y and x
Answer:
x = 2 and y = 1
Step-by-step explanation:
First, solve for y by substituting the second equation as x into the first equation
-2x - 3y = -7
-2(y + 1) - 3y = -7
Simplify and solve for y
-2y - 2 - 3y = -7
-5y - 2 = -7
-5y = -5
y = 1
Solve for x by plugging in 1 into the second equation
y + 1 = x
1 + 1 = x
2 = x
So, the answer is x = 2 and y = 1
